#f00da0 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#f00da0 is composed of 94.1% red, 5.1%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.6% magenta, 33.3%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 321.1 degrees, a saturation of 89.7% and a lightness of 49.6%. #f00da0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1aff with #e10041. Closest websafe color is: #ff0099.

#f00da0 color description : Vivid pink.

The hexadecimal color #f00da0 has RGB values of R:240, G:13, B:160 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.95, Y:0.33,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15732128.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#11010b is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#857880 is the less saturated color, while #fa03a3 is the most saturated one.
